Frequently Asked Questions about Coppin Heights

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Coppin Heights area of Baltimore, MD?

As of today, July 27, 2026, there are currently 1,214 available Coppin Heights apartments priced from $550 to $4,381, with an average monthly rent of $1,484.

How much are Studio apartments in Coppin Heights?

There are currently 312 Studio Apartments in Coppin Heights with rent ranges from $900 to $1,999 with an average price of $1,362.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Coppin Heights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Coppin Heights ranges from $550 to $3,232 with an average monthly rent of $1,273.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Coppin Heights c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Coppin Heights range from $850 to $4,381.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,586.

How expensive are Coppin Heights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 116 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Coppin Heights on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,000 to $3,165 - averaging $1,934 for the location.
